        !            39:
        !            40: extern char **environ;
        !            41:
        !            42: int
        !            43: execvp(const char *name, char * const *argv)
        !            44: {
        !            45:        const char **memp;
        !            46:        int cnt;
        !            47:        size_t lp, ln = 0;
        !            48:        int eacces = 0;
        !            49:        unsigned int etxtbsy = 0;
        !            50:        char buf[PATH_MAX];
        !            51:        const char *bp, *path, *p;
        !            52:
        !            53:        /* "" is not a valid filename; check this before traversing PATH. */
        !            54:        if (name[0] == '\0') {
        !            55:                errno = ENOENT;
        !            56:                goto done;
        !            57:        }
        !            58:        /* If it's an absolute or relative path name, it's easy. */
        !            59:        if (strchr(name, '/')) {
        !            60:                bp = name;
        !            61:                path = "";
        !            62:                goto retry;
        !            63:        }
        !            64:        bp = buf;
        !            65:
        !            66:        /* Get the path we're searching. */
        !            67:        if (!(path = getenv("PATH")))
        !            68:                path = _PATH_DEFPATH;
        !            69:
        !            70:        ln = strlen(name);
        !            71:        do {
        !            72:                /* Find the end of this path element. */
        !            73:                for (p = path; *path != 0 && *path != ':'; path++)
        !            74:                        continue;
        !            75:                /*
        !            76:                 * It's a SHELL path -- double, leading and trailing colons
        !            77:                 * mean the current directory.
        !            78:                 */
        !            79:                if (p == path) {
        !            80:                        p = ".";
        !            81:                        lp = 1;
        !            82:                } else
        !            83:                        lp = path - p;
        !            84:
        !            85:                /*
        !            86:                 * If the path is too long complain.  This is a possible
        !            87:                 * security issue; given a way to make the path too long
        !            88:                 * the user may execute the wrong program.
        !            89:                 */
        !            90:                if (lp + ln + 2 > sizeof(buf))
        !            91:                        continue;
        !            92:                memcpy(buf, p, lp);
        !            93:                buf[lp] = '/';
        !            94:                memcpy(buf + lp + 1, name, ln);
        !            95:                buf[lp + ln + 1] = '\0';
        !            96:
        !            97: retry:         (void)execve(bp, argv, environ);
        !            98:                switch (errno) {
        !            99:                case EACCES:
        !           100:                        eacces = 1;
        !           101:                        break;
        !           102:                case ENOTDIR:
        !           103:                case ENOENT:
        !           104:                        break;
        !           105:                case ENOEXEC:
        !           106:                        for (cnt = 0; argv[cnt] != NULL; ++cnt)
        !           107:                                continue;
        !           108:                        if ((memp = alloca((cnt + 2) * sizeof(*memp))) == NULL)
        !           109:                                goto done;
        !           110:                        memp[0] = _PATH_BSHELL;
        !           111:                        memp[1] = bp;
        !           112:                        (void)memcpy(&memp[2], &argv[1], cnt * sizeof(*memp));
        !           113:                        (void)execve(_PATH_BSHELL, (char * const *)memp,
        !           114:                            environ);
        !           115:                        goto done;
        !           116:                case ETXTBSY:
        !           117:                        if (etxtbsy < 3)
        !           118:                                (void)sleep(++etxtbsy);
        !           119:                        goto retry;
        !           120:                default:
        !           121:                        goto done;
        !           122:                }
        !           123:        } while (*path++ == ':');       /* Otherwise, *path was NUL */
        !           124:        if (eacces)
        !           125:                errno = EACCES;
        !           126:        else if (!errno)
        !           127:                errno = ENOENT;
        !           128: done:
        !           129:        return (-1);
        !           130: }
